Corporate Photography for the Pantherella AW2012 Brochure

Towards the end of summer last year I was contacted by Pantherella, a local manufacturer of high quality English socks with a proposal for some corporate photography. They were about to start work on their new advertising campaign and needed a photographer to get the product photography and lifestyle photography for their new brochures. Of course I jumped at the chance to be involved in such a large campaign. Read on to see how I got on!

The Pantherella family has three main brands, Pantherella Men, Pantherella Women and Scott Nichol. Each brand has a distinctive look – whereas Pantherella man is aimed at the discerning English businessman, Scott Nichol is at the upper end of the outdoor sock market. Pantherella has an excellent reputation within the industry, so it was a pleasure to be able to work with them to create their brochures.

Whereas I’d be doing the product photography side of the shoot (hundreds of socks on fake legs in front of a white background) in my own studio environment, there were still the ‘lifestyle’ shots to be taken – those showing the socks in ‘typical’ situations. However, as the brief was for quirky shots, you may not find too many of the following lifestyle images ‘typical’!

Before we started on the shoot, I decided that because the focus of these shots was the socks, and because I needed to bring out the quality of these socks in a single image then I needed to shoot the products a certain way. There was only one choice for the job, and that was for the Canon 100mm f2.8L IS macro lens. Utterly sharp as a knife with a beautiful optical quality, combined with my 5D Mark II left no doubt that I’d be able to show the quality of the garment.

The shoots took place over a period of a few days. The first day was at The City Rooms in Leicester, where we were shooting Pantherella Men – the main brand. I was working alongside the marketing team at Pantherella, as well as Ian from The Message – the design agency, so I decided to shoot tethered to my laptop so they could check the quality and look of the images as they were being shot.

As we were shooting inside, and after dark, I used my Canon 430EXII speedlight, married to my PocketWizard FlexTT5 and shooting through a large softbox in a one light configuration to light the scenes. The lighting was consistent to ensure that there was a uniform look and feel throughout the brochure.

There were a lot of socks to get through, so having the lights set up, shooting tethered and using the PocketWizards allowed us to move from product to product to complete the shoot efficiently.

The next day we moved on to The Exchange Bar in Leicester to do the Pantherella Women shoot. Again, the 5D Mark II, 100mm Macro, Pocketwizard combination was used for the consistent look I was striving for.

Finally, at the weekend we ventured outside to shoot the Scott Nichol range. Again, the same equipment was used for consistency – although this time I wasn’t tethered to the laptop!

Within a few weeks of the shoot, after I’d done my initial edit and passed the photos over to The Message for pagination, the brochures arrived. Pantherella couldn’t have been happier, and I was delighted to see how well the photographs had come out in print. The brochures were extremely well received by all, and the brochures and photographs from the shoot were used as a major part of Pantherella’s advertising at the Pitti trade show early in 2012.
